The Landscape of Tower Defense Games on Mobile Platforms
The tower defense genre, historically rooted in PC and console ecosystems, has seamlessly transitioned into the mobile realm due to its inherently scalable gameplay. According to Newzoo’s 2022 report, mobile tower defense games command approximately 15% of the global mobile gaming market shares, underscoring their popularity and commercial viability.
Popular titles like Kingdom Rush and Plants vs. Zombies have set industry standards not only for engaging gameplay but also for effective monetization strategies—primarily through microtransactions, ad integrations, and premium purchases. The success of these titles hinges on designing immersive, strategically rich experiences accessible across a variety of Android devices, which constitute about 72% of the mobile market according to DeviceAtlas 2023 data.
Technical Considerations for Cross-Device Accessibility
| Aspect | Consideration | Implication |
|---|---|---|
| Device Compatibility | Ensuring optimized performance across Android variants | Maximizes reach and reduces friction, fostering higher retention rates |
| Graphics & UI Scaling | Adaptive design for diverse screen sizes | Provides seamless user experience, reducing drop-offs |
| Network Optimization | Handling varied data connection speeds | Minimizes latency issues, crucial for real-time strategy gameplay |
Addressing these technical challenges not only enhances user satisfaction but also underpins effective monetization strategies. Developers need to provide options for different hardware capabilities, especially considering Android’s fragmentation.
The Role of User Engagement and Monetization Strategies
“Engagement in tower defense games is profoundly influenced by in-game progression systems, dynamic difficulty adjustments, and social features. Monetization, on the other hand, hinges on providing value-driven purchase options without alienating non-paying players.” – Industry Analyst, Gaming Insights 2023
Effective engagement sustains a game’s lifecycle, incentivizing players to return through daily rewards, seasonal events, and leaderboards. Monetization models—ranging from in-app purchases for upgrades to rewarded ads—must be delicately balanced to uphold user trust and fairness.
